About Procore MCP Server

Connect your Procore construction management platform to any AI agent and oversee projects, quality, and field operations through natural conversation.

Mastra's agent abstraction provides a clean separation between LLM logic and Procore tool infrastructure. Connect 8 tools through Vinkius and use Mastra's built-in workflow engine to chain tool calls with conditional logic, retries, and parallel execution. deployable to any Node.js host in one command.

What you can do

  • Projects Overview — List all active construction projects with status, addresses, timelines, and budget summaries
  • RFIs & Submittals — Track Requests for Information and material approvals with assignees, due dates, and response histories
  • Field Observations — Review safety and quality observations from the jobsite including priority, photos, and corrective actions
  • Punch Lists — Monitor deficiencies to resolve before closeout with locations, assignees, and deadlines
  • Daily Logs — Access daily logs with weather, workforce counts, equipment usage, and delay notes
  • Drawings — Browse blueprints, elevations, and shop drawings with revision tracking

Procore + Mastra AI FAQ

Common questions about integrating Procore MCP Server with Mastra AI.

01

How does Mastra AI connect to MCP servers?

Create an MCPClient with the server URL and pass it to your agent. Mastra discovers all tools and makes them available with full TypeScript types.
02

Can Mastra agents use tools from multiple servers?

Yes. Pass multiple MCP clients to the agent constructor. Mastra merges all tool schemas and the agent can call any tool from any server.
03

Does Mastra support workflow orchestration?

Yes. Mastra has a built-in workflow engine that lets you chain MCP tool calls with branching logic, error handling, and parallel execution.
